CVE-2026-42438
Last modified
CVE-2026-42438 is a medium-severity vulnerability rated 4.9/10 on the CVSS scale. OpenClaw versions 2026.4.9 before 2026.4.10 contain a sender policy bypass vulnerability in the outbound host-media attachment read helper that allows unauthorized local file disclosure. Attackers with denied read access via toolsBySender or group policy can trigger host-media attachment loading to bypass sender and group-scoped authorization boundaries and retrieve readable local files through the outbound media path.. EPSS estimates a 0.24% chance of exploitation in the next 30 days.
